The final bill for a full home remodel depends on several moving parts. The biggest factors are the square footage of the space and the quality of the materials you select, such as custom cabinetry or high-end flooring. Structural changes—like moving walls, plumbing, or electrical systems—also shift the budget significantly compared to simple cosmetic updates. Renovating in Fort Lauderdale often means restoring your home to its original condition or updating its existing features. Remodeling implies more substantial changes, such as altering room layouts, adding square footage, or changing the function of a space. Both can significantly improve your property.
